Job Description:

As a Senior Branch Manager at , you will be responsible for overseeing the operations and performance of our branch location. You will lead a team of professionals, manage day-to-day activities, and ensure that the branch meets or exceeds sales targets while maintaining high levels of customer satisfaction. The ideal candidate will have strong leadership skills, a background in sales or operations management, and a deep understanding of the plywood industry.

Responsibilities:

Team Leadership:
Lead, mentor, and motivate a team of sales representatives, warehouse staff, and administrative personnel to achieve individual and team goals.

Sales Management:
Develop and implement sales strategies to drive revenue growth and meet sales targets. Monitor sales performance, analyze sales data, and identify opportunities for improvement.

Customer Relationship Management:
Build and maintain strong relationships with customers, dealers, and distributors. Address customer inquiries, concerns, and complaints in a timely and professional manner.

Inventory Management:
Oversee inventory levels, replenishment, and stock rotation to ensure adequate supply and minimize stock outs. Work closely with the procurement team to optimize inventory levels and manage costs.

Operational Efficiency:
Streamline branch operations to improve efficiency and reduce costs. Identify process improvements and implement best practices to enhance productivity and profitability.

Budgeting and Financial Management:
Develop annual budgets and financial forecasts for the branch. Monitor expenses, manage budgets, and ensure compliance with financial guidelines and targets.

Compliance and Safety:
Ensure compliance with company policies, procedures, and safety regulations. Conduct regular audits and inspections to maintain a safe and secure work environment.

Market Analysis:
Stay informed about market trends, competitor activities, and industry developments. Conduct market research and analysis to identify new opportunities and threats.

Reporting:
Prepare regular reports on sales performance, inventory levels, expenses, and other key metrics. Present findings to senior management and make recommendations for improvement.

Customer Service Excellence:
Uphold the company's reputation for excellence in customer service. Monitor customer feedback and satisfaction levels, and take proactive measures to address any issues or concerns.

Qualifications:

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Sales, Marketing, or a related field. MBA preferred.
Proven experience in sales management, branch management, or operations management, preferably in the plywood or building materials industry.
Strong leadership skills with the ability to inspire and motivate teams to achieve goals.
Excellent communication, negotiation, and interpersonal skills.
Sound knowledge of sales techniques, customer relationship management, and inventory management principles.
Analytical mindset with the ability to interpret sales data and market trends.
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and other relevant software applications.
Ability to work effectively under pressure and me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
Willingness to travel as needed.
